1. Cognitive Agility Gets a Boost

To stay ahead in the game, players need to be on their toes, mentally tracking each number and ensuring it aligns with their card. This seemingly simple task, however, is a brilliant workout for the brain. Bingo sharpens overall brain health, including cognitive agility, enhancing memory retention, attention to detail, and multitasking skills.

2. Social Bonds Flourish

Bingo is more than just a game; it’s a social event that bridges generations. As players gather around tables, a sense of camaraderie blooms. Conversations spark between rounds, laughter fills the air, and friendships form over shared strategies and friendly competition. For older adults, especially those prone to social isolation, bingo offers a gateway to forge meaningful connections.

3. Stress Takes a Backseat

Life’s whirlwind can leave us feeling overwhelmed, but bingo provides a reprieve from stress’s unrelenting grip. As balls are drawn and numbers matched, cortisol levels take a dip, replaced by a surge of endorphins – the body’s natural stress-busters.

4. Focus and Patience Reign Supreme

Winning at bingo requires a blend of focus and patience – qualities that spill over into the realm of everyday life. Whether it’s tackling a complex project at work or navigating traffic during rush hour, the skills honed at the bingo table can be unexpectedly handy in various situations.

5. Cognitive Reserve Gets a Nudge

Bingo doesn’t just entertain; it challenges the mind, thereby contributing to the concept of cognitive reserve. This reserve, built over time through mental activities like bingo, acts as a buffer against cognitive decline, potentially reducing the risk of conditions such as Alzheimer’s disease.

6. A Welcoming Brain Workout

Bingo is no one-trick pony. Its variants – from traditional to themed versions – offer players a delightful variety that keeps the brain engaged. Whether it’s matching numbers in a straight line or aiming for the four corners, bingo’s adaptability ensures players never get bored.

7. Hand-Eye Coordination Finessed

The swift dabbing of a marker on the card demands precision and hand-eye coordination. Players might not realize it, but this seemingly mundane act fine-tunes motor skills, contributing to improved coordination in daily activities.
